Evaluation of rail irregularities by processing tramway vehicle bogie acceleration data
Krešimir Burnać,
Ivo HaladinDOI: https://doi.org/10.5592/CO/cetra.2024.1742
Abstract
Acceleration data on in-service tramway vehicles provides helpful information related to the track condition. It represents advantages in terms of measurement frequency, the elimination of the requirement for additional track occupancy for measurements, and safety of operations on the track. However, the collected acceleration data must be further processed to provide more precise information on rail surface irregularities and defects. Detecting and evaluating irregularities from bogie frame acceleration requires extensive signal processing along with determining track, vehicle, and operational parameters. For more precise results and better approach, the vibro-acoustic characteristics of the track, vehicle, and wheels should be investigated in more detail in order to create transfer functions, along with evaluating the condition of the rail and wheel roughness. The aim of this paper is to investigate the current state of the art, as well as to present some preliminary measurements and analyses connected to this topic.
Keywords
rail irregularities; bogie frame acceleration; transfer functions; vibro-acoustic parameters; tramway vehicle
